SECTION 2 PRODUCT DESCRIPTION
INTRODUCTION
YORK YLAA Air-Cooled Scroll Chillers provide
chilled water for all air conditioning applications us-
ing central station air handling or terminal units. They
are completely self-contained and are designed for out-
door (roof or ground level) installation. Each complete
packaged unit includes hermetic scroll compressors, a
liquid cooler, air cooled condenser, a charge of Zero
Ozone Depletion Potential Refrigerant R-410A and
a weather resistant microprocessor control center, all
mounted on a rugged steel base.
The units are completely assembled with all intercon-
necting refrigerant piping and internal wiring, ready
for field installation.
Before delivery, the packaged unit is pressure-tested,
evacuated, and fully charged with Refrigerant R-410A
and oil. After assembly, a complete operational test is
performed with water flowing through the cooler to
ensure that the refrigeration circuit operates correctly.
The unit structure is heavy-gauge, galvanized steel.
This galvanized steel is coated with baked-on powder
paint, which, when subjected to ASTM B117 1000
hour, salt spray testing, yields a minimum ASTM 1654
rating of “6”. Units are designed in accordance with
NFPA 70 (National Electric Code), ASHRAE/ANSI 15
Safety code for mechanical refrigeration, ASME, and
rated in accordance with ARI Standard 550/590.
GENERAL SYSTEM DESCRIPTION
Compressors
The chiller has suction-gas cooled, hermetic, scroll
compressors. The YLAA compressors incorporate a
compliant scroll design in both the axial and radial
direction. All rotating parts are statically and dynami-
cally balanced. A large internal volume and oil res-
ervoir provides greater liquid tolerance. Compressor
crankcase heaters are also included for extra protection
against liquid migration.
Brazed Plate Evaporator
The compact, high efficiency Brazed Plate Heat Ex-
changer (BPHE) is constructed with 316L stainless
steel corrugated channel plates with a filler material
between each plate. It offers excellent heat transfer
performance with a compact size and low weight, re-
ducing structural steel requirements on the job site.
The heat exchanger is manufactured in a precisely con-
trolled vacuum-brazing process that allows the filler
material to form a brazed joint at every contact point
between the plates, creating complex channels. The ar-
rangement is similar to older plate and frame technol-
ogy, but without gaskets and frame parts.
Water inlet and outlet connections are grooved for
compatibility with field supplied ANSI/AWWA C-606
couplings.
